Weedkiller dangers to health.
We were oblivious to the dangers of Glysophate-based weedkillers (such as Roundup) until Drugswatch. com approached us.
​
'Roundup is a popular residential and commercial weed killer made with glyphosate. Farmers, landscapers and agricultural workers have used it since 1974. However, some studies have linked heavy glyphosate use to an increased risk of non-Hodgkin lymphoma and other cancers.'
​
Whilst it seems the United States EPA is not on board, the rest of the world is, with a growing list of countries and regions banning its use. These can be found here as part of a billion-dollar lawsuit against Bayer & Monsanto.
